I call it a rock garden!  Bedrock lies about 10 cms under the surface or under the road base, clay and granitic sand on which the house sits providing the ultimate gardening challenge!

The objective is to make a garden that is low maintenance, environmentally friendly and water-wise, all on a small budget.  Steep slopes are planted with native shrubs set into excavated pockets to provide ground stability and shelter for birds and blue tongues.

Olive trees provide structure and shelter from sun and wind are under planted with leucophyta brownii (cushion bush), native grasses, prostrate casuarina, rosemary and salt bush. Ornamental oregano and geranium Roxanne, sedum, lychnis (rose campion), salvias, and penstemon provide colour.  Ornamental grape vines grown on wires provide summer shade for the house and autumn brilliance.

The lower level has a clump of silver princess underplanted with coreas, grevilleas and other natives and provides cooler shady relief in summer.  A small courtyard on the southern side offers a sheltered shady spot for summer dining, grevilleas, callistemons and hakeas sustain honey eaters and other small birds.

This garden is very much a work in progress and hopefully will provide encouragement to those dealing with new gardens and challenging conditions.
